A guessing game in which the "20Q" A.I. will try to read your mind by asking a few simple questions. The object you think of should be something that most people would know about, but not a proper noun or a specific person, place, or thing.

This 2012 update of the classic Jeopardy! quiz game includes 3,000 clues in the Jeopardy!, Double Jeopardy! and Final Jeopardy! formats. The game also includes the premier of the "Jeopardy! Clue Crew" for the first time in a home game format, while also featuring host Alex Trebek and announcer Johnny Gilbert. Between rounds multiplayer mini-games are offered as breaks. Online multiplayer is supported to play against other players.
Akinator, the Web Genie (formerly Akinator, the web Genius) is an internet game and mobile app based on Twenty Questions that attempts to determine which character the player is thinking of by asking them a series of questions. It is an artificial intelligence program that can find and learn the best questions to ask the player. Created by three French programmers in 2007, it became popular worldwide in November 2008, according to Google Trends. In Europe popularity peak was reached in 2009 and Japan in 2010 with the launch of mobile apps by French mobile company SCIMOB, reaching highest ranks on app store . While playing "Akinator", questions are asked by a cartoon genie.
